I was on LMDE a year or two ago. I still found it a little 'one-step-removed'. Cinnamon is in the Debian repos now - just use Debian testing or unstable.


rmadison claims that it is only in sid, which is an important distinction, as current testing will soon be released as Wheezy.


A good point, though for most techies, running sid/Unstable should be alright on their desktop.


But so should testing – it does offer some stability and the remote guarantee that packages are installable, plus you get upgrades to stable for free at each release.
